International Mummers' Festival, Gloucester, England

The Festival will be taking place on the following days:

  • 5th December - Symposium and Night Mumming
  • 6th December - Mumming around the city, workshops, Mummers unplugged.

There are still places available for more performing sides. If you wish to take part, e-mail Stephen Rowley at steve@artension.com. Think of it as a dress rehearsal with knobs on.

Mummers Festival 2014, St. John's, Newfoundland, Canada

The schedule for this year's festival is now available. Various events and workshops will be taking place throughout December, with the big parade round town on the afternoon of December 13th. It's probably not too late to book a flight!
